From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:

  Ahriman \Ah"ri*man\, n. [Per.]
     The Evil Principle or Being of the ancient Persians; the
     Prince of Darkness as opposer to Ormuzd, the King of Light.
     [1913 Webster]

From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:



  Ahriman
       n : the spirit of evil in Zoroastrianism; arch rival of Ormazd
